Principle III of the department of defense states, 'If held in captivity you should communicate and organize with the community of fellow united states government and allied captives and avoid actions that may harm them.'

The National Security Act of 1947 established the National Military Establishment, which was replaced by the Department of Defense (DOD) (50 U.S.C. 401). The executive branch department of the federal government known as the United States Department of Defense is in charge of organizing and managing all government departments and agencies that are directly involved with national security and the American armed forces. The secretary of defense, a cabinet-level official who answers directly to the American president, is in charge of the Department of Defense. The Department of the Army, the Department of the Navy, and the Department of the Air Force are the three military departments that report to the Department of Defense.

Answer:D) the bond is probably being called by the issuer because interest rates went up

This statement is not true because when interest rates go up the issuer is at an advantage as he had previously borrowed money at a interest rate which is lower than the present interest rate, as interest rates have risen. Also when interest rates rise and the issuer calls the bond he will have to pay higher interest to re borrow money and this is foolish thus the issuer will not call the bond when interest rates rise. The issuer will call the bond when interest rates fall, as the issuer can re issue the bonds and borrow money at lower interest rates.

Determinants of Interest Rates The real risk-free rate is 4%. Inflation is expected to be 4% this year, 5% next year, and then 4.5% thereafter. The maturity risk premium is estimated to be 0.0006 × (t - 1), where t = number of years to maturity. What is the nominal interest rate on a 7-year Treasury security?

The nominal interest rate = 8.86%.

Explanation:

Average inflation premium = (4%+5%+4.5%+4.5%+4.5%+4.5%+4.5%)/7 = 31.5%/7 = 4.50%

Maturity risk premium for 7 year bond = 0.0006 * (7-1) = 0.36%

Nominal interest rate = real risk free rate + inflation premium + maturity risk premium = 4% + 4.50% + 0.36% = 8.86%.

Therefore, the nominal interest rate for the question given = 8.86%.
